Cogency Software, a provider of software and services for institutional investors, reports that Aurora Investment Management has chosen it for its partnership accounting and portfolio management platform.
Headquartered in Chicago, Aurora Investment Management is a manager of hedge fund portfolios. Since its founding in 1988, Aurora has provided portfolio solutions to institutional and individual clients, including corporate and public pension funds, foundations and endowments, insurance companies, and healthcare organisations. Since 1995, Aurora has provided customised portfolio solutions to clients to help them meet their specific investment objectives.
When it came time to evaluate new software, Cogency emerged as the solution that could best handle the sophisticated accounting and reporting needs of Aurora’s investment operations.
“We wanted a system that could meet our operational needs as our business grows,” said Anne Marie Morley, partner and managing director of operations at Aurora. “Cogency supports the various fee structures, allocation methods, and asset classes we have today or may need in the future. With Cogency, we can focus on expanding our business and not feel constrained by our technology.”
